Seaweeds have hit the mainstream of American cuisine, moving beyond a tasty wrapping for sushi rolls and entering our diets through seaweed chips, salad dressings, and even as a hot dog topping.
Dieticians tout seaweeds for their protein and fiber content, along with essential nutrients such as calcium, iron, magnesium, iodine, and tyrosine. Seaweeds support gut health, and research points to a possible role in the prevention of heart disease and diabetes.
Seaweeds’ benefits aren’t limited to humans. From years of research into animal diets, it is clear that certain varieties are powerful health boosters for pets.
But not all of the world’s more than 100 seaweed species seaweeds are equal. Many lack enough nutritional research to support health claims, while others have qualities that are not desirable in pet food—such as excessive mineral levels, contamination from pollutants, or low palatability.

About 70 percent of an animal’s immune system is in the digestive tract, and that’s where the benefits of Tasco® begin.
Several powerful prebiotics occur naturally in Tasco®, including several exclusive to marine plants, such as alginate oligosaccharides (AOS), laminarin and fucoidan. Research has verified the beneficial effects of these prebiotics, which work synergistically to boost the balance of helpful bacteria and microbes in the gastrointestinal tract.
Tasco® also helps animals fight off gastrointestinal infections like Escherichia coli and salmonella. While scientists have not yet identified the exact mechanism behind the reduction in pathogens, one candidate is Tasco®’s unique combination of tannins and other polyphenols, which are known to have strong antimicrobial properties.
